LP17 YPF is a 2017 Kia Sportage in Blue with a 1,685c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.
Across all 2017 Kia Sportage models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.6% with a typical mileage of 44,910 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Kia Sportage fails its MOT is br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ick, accounting for 16,003 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LP17 YPF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Sportage typ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 9 years old, this Kia Sportage is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
